Output 8d66a85d4e4edc629f05daee802d6243f524c418211d26c95e5ae924094150d8:14

value
520000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26ffcdb39a781a61c318a459efa05922103c1484 OP_EQUAL
address
35FE3Nd2MjSaGZewWHRurTbqjNrSYL7tzb
transaction
8d66a85d4e4edc629f05daee802d6243f524c418211d26c95e5ae924094150d8
spent
true